张克宇,李明钢,胡春辉
(云南电网有限责任公司昆明供电局,云南 昆明 650000)
变电站可视化巡视作业指导书APP的开发
张克宇,李明钢,胡春辉
(云南电网有限责任公司昆明供电局,云南 昆明 650000)
介绍了一种跨平台的电力设备可视化巡视作业指导书APP。该APP采用JavaScript脚本语言编写,以变电站实际场景为模型,对现场设备及检查内容进行仿真模拟,且支持巡视数据及图片的远程传送。将其安装在各类移动设备上,可直观地指导现场巡视作业。
电力设备;巡检;可视化;作业指导书;手机APP
电力设备巡检是保障设备安全稳定运行的一项基础性工作,通过巡检能掌握变电站设备的运行情况,为设备状态评价、运行方式选择、检修计划安排等工作提供可靠、详细的数据。随着电力系统的发展,电网规模越来越庞大,班组运行维护人员管辖的变电站越来越多,各变电站一、二次设备往往来自不同厂家,各厂家设备巡视要点不尽相同,增加了运行维护工作的难度。利用先进的信息技术辅助功能,帮助运行维护人员更好地了解设备参数与作业流程,可以有效地提高巡检效率,极大程度地减少人因失误。
目前的电力设备巡检质量管控,主要通过现场巡视作业指导书实现。传统的纸质巡视作业指导书有文字表单类作业指导书和图文可视化类作业指导书2种。前者主要用于提示、记录巡检内容,属于粗放型管理,实际工作指导意义不大;后者主要用来指导现场巡检工作,避免由于运行人员工作经验不足造成漏项、误判等情况。
在传统的使用纸质巡视作业指导书进行巡检过程中,大量的纸质资料在巡视工作中存在携带不方便、查阅耗时长等缺点,因此开发一种基于手机APP的可视化巡视作业指导书应用软件十分必要。
2.1 开发步骤
基于JavaScript脚本语言开发,以变电站实际场景为模型,针对触摸式移动终端,设计出一套与现场一致、与现场设备相符的软件模拟APP。该APP可直观指导现场巡视作业,且支持现场巡视数据及图片远程传送。软件具备可视化变电站地图场景、设备巡视路线、设备检查流程以及巡检结果自动记录等功能。该软件的开发过程分为以下几个步骤。
(1) 方案设计。根据变电站巡视作业指导书的功能要求,制定系统需达到的目标和效果,形成总体实施方案,指导后续工作的开展。
(2) 软件构架设计。系统地设计软件整体结构、组件及接口实现方法,作为系统方案实现的基础。
(3) 材料收集。收集变电站环境图片、设备外观图片、不同设备巡视检查要点及注意事项等素材。
(4) 根据相关规程、制度要求,规划巡视路线、设计设备检查流程,并分类整理,方便后续取用。
(5) 绘图、美化。根据软件设计需求及现场情况,利用Photoshop等图片处理软件,将材料处理成编程可用素材。
(6) 编写代码。根据软件构架设计结果,编写各组件功能及接口代码,实现巡视路线控制、巡视流程控制、巡视结果自动记录及远传等功能。
(7) 软件测试、修改、完善。在变电站试用一段时间后,根据试用情况提出改进建议并修改完善。
2.2 开发工具及运行环境要求
选用RPG Maker软件作为开发平台,该软件是一款角色扮演游戏制作软件,目前有多个版本,本工程选用的是MV Version 1.0.1版。软件运行环境要求配置Windows 7或Mac OS X 10.10及以上的操作系统,CPU采用Intel Core 2 Duo同等或更高,内存2 GB以上,显卡分辨率1 280×768以上且支持OpenGL,硬盘剩余空间2 GB以上。
RPG Maker MV的脚本系统是开源的,使用JavaScript作为内部脚本语言,开发者能根据需求修改或添加代码,制作出更符合现场实际效果的功能、界面等。在可视化巡检仪实例中,通过添加插件、脚本来实现巡视数据处理、巡视结果判定等功能。
使用RPG Maker MV开发的变电站可视化巡视作业指导书软件,可以使用其自带的打包功能,将软件部署成可以在Windows系统、Mac OS X系统、Android/IOS系统上运行的APP。软件对运行环境的要求很低,只要支持HTML5即可。
3.1 关键点
该可视化巡视作业指导书基于JavaScript脚本语言,使用RPG Maker MV软件平台开发,对变电站场景、设备进行仿真并制作成场景,再通过变量控制巡视路线及设备检查流程,使用数组记录巡视结果,达到有效指导运行人员现场巡视工作的效果,是行之有效的现场作业质量管控工具。
3.2 创新点
采用可视化巡视作业指导书APP代替传统的纸质作业指导书,可以提高资料查阅速度,提高工作效率。
APP采用程序语言设定的巡视流程,根据巡视人员所在的场景,提示巡视任务完成情况,有效防止因传统经验巡视造成遗漏巡视项目的问题。
APP采用程序语言设定的设备检查流程,加入了大量互动性强的图文对照检查选项,运行人员必须根据既定流程选择,可以有效避免遗漏设备巡视内容。
APP采用程序语言设定的设备自动判定功能,根据巡视人员的选择结果自动判定设备状态,避免由于运行人员技能不足造成的误判、错判。
APP具有自动生成巡视记录,并支持远传巡视数据及图片的功能,提高了工作效率。
该APP解决了传统纸质作业指导书存在的实用性低、携带不方便、查阅耗时长等缺点,有效防止人为因素造成的巡检漏项、误判等问题,确保巡视质量。同时,由于JavaScript脚本语言的特点,APP能在任意移动平台运行,没有系统兼容问题,实现真正的跨平台应用。
4.1 程序模块划分
该可视化巡视作业指导书APP分为日常巡视和特殊巡视2大模块,其中日常巡视包含变电一、二次设备及辅助设施周期性巡视内容,如设备外观检查、状态量抄录、声光检查等内容;特殊巡视模块包含变电设备跳闸特殊巡视、恶劣气候特殊巡视、保供电设备特殊巡视等内容。不同巡视任务的巡视内容、路线不尽相同,使用者可以根据实际情况,选择相应的巡视任务开展工作。
4.2 各模块功能
日常巡视模式下,巡视路线以设备间隔或房间为基本场景。每个场景中需要巡视检查的设备处都设有任务提示按钮,巡视人员点击按钮触发巡视内容后,程序会在页面中显示需巡视内容的图片、文字要求及是否正常的选择项,根据实际情况选择对应选项。每个场景中的巡视任务完成后自动触发下一个场景,直到完成整个变电站的全部巡视工作。
特殊巡视模式下,巡视路线基于特殊巡视具体内容。软件根据巡视人员选择的特殊巡视类型,自动后台运算,判断需巡检的区域、设备,然后自动切入相关场景并生成巡检任务提示按钮。巡视人员点击任务提示按钮触发巡视任务,并根据现场实际情况做出选择,直至完成特殊巡视任务。
变电站可视化巡视作业指导书软件于2014年10月完成1.0版本开发,并已试用。通过1年多的实践,证明该可视化巡检作业指导书软件能有效提高巡视效率,保证巡检质量,有效避免因人员巡视不到位造成的风险。软件在试用中积累了大量使用经验,同时收集到了许多有用的建议,开发人员将参考这些建议对软件进行升级。
变电站可视化巡视作业指导书作为一种全新的班组管理工具,有效解决了纸质作业指导书存在的问题,细化了现场作业管控措施,终结了运行人员凭经验完成设备巡视工作的传统巡检模式,确保了巡视质量。
从全新角度出发,借鉴游戏制作的思路,利用RPG Maker MV软件制作的变电站可视化巡视作业指导书APP,具有界面友好、使用简单、富有娱乐色彩、易于接受等特点,经实践使用效果良好,可供电力系统相关专业人员参考。该APP已于2015-07-23获得国家知识产权局软件著作权专利,具有实用价值,值得在电力系统推广。
1 程辉海,王谌红,文书华,等.浅析铁路电力设备巡视检查可视化工作[J].成铁科技,2013,(1):3-4.
2 董勤伟.变电运行仿真培训系统开发方向探讨[J].电力设备,2006,7(2):50-52.
2016-09-27。
张克宇(1987-),男,助理工程师,主要从事变电运行工作,email:313971315@qq.com。
李明钢(1985-),男,工程师,主要从事变电运行工作。
胡春辉(1988-),女,助理工程师,主要从事变电运行工作。